Structuring its analysis around buildings, industry and transport, the report assessed the combined impact of achievable demand-side interventions on global energy intensity.The three key challenges that companies are contending with against the backdrop of the ongoing energy transition involve maintaining a secure and stable energy supply amid an increasingly volatile geopolitical landscape; ensuring that energy is economically viable for businesses and societies; and meeting the growing energy demand while aligning with the goals of the 2050 Paris Agreement, the report said.
As a third lever, it recommends collaboration measures across the value chain, such as changing building design, putting in place district heating and cooling systems and district energy management systems, on-site energy production and storage, and the use of greener materials as well as demand response programs.
